Description Jakub Steiner 2012-04-24 12:01:05 UTC
For the short term, we should cover the essential set of application icons in high contrast. A few to start with:

gnome-documents
gnome-boxes
devhelp
evolution
shotwell
cheese
file-roller
gnome-disk-utility
evince

In the long term, it would be wise to mandate apps to ship a symbolic variant of the app icon to genrate/render the high/low contrast variants.
Comment 1 Lapo Calamandrei 2012-05-19 13:43:14 UTC
we should include the symbolic icon in our one-canvas-workflow template somehow and adapt the scripts to generate them as well. We're shipping the stencils in the scalable dir, so we may find conflicts in the systemwide hicolor theme (we could use the hc hierarchy, but having everything in hicolor would be better). I guess we should try to define some sort of fdo standard in the long run.
